Our team has recently helped high level individuals and firms being investigated for the following types of market abuse:

  • Insider trading
    When a person intends to trade on the basis of inside information they have acquired.
  • Improper disclosure
    This is where an insider improperly reveals inside information to another person. This can be verbal or printed information.
  • Misuse of information
    Where your behaviour is based on information that is not generally available, but would influence a decision about whether or not to invest or trade.
  • Manipulating transactions
    Trading, or placing orders to trade, that gives a false or misleading impression of the products or supply, raising the price of the investment to an abnormal or artificial level.
  • Manipulating devices
    Trading, or placing orders to trade, which employs fictitious devices or any other form of deception.
  • Dissemination
    Passing on information that conveys a false or misleading impression about an investment or the issuer of an investment when you know the information to be false or misleading.
  • Distortion and misleading behaviour
    When you give false or misleading impressions of either the supply of, or demand for, an investment; or behaviour that otherwise distorts the market in an investment.
